CVE-2026-5546
Campcodes Complete Online Learning Management System Crud_model.php add_lesson unrestricted upload
Description

A flaw has been found in Campcodes Complete Online Learning Management System 1.0. This impacts the function add_lesson of the file /application/models/Crud_model.php. This manipulation causes unrestricted upload.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been published and may be used.
